Bio
Marc develops strategic, mission-driven communications that enhance Lever for Change’s ability to influence global impact. He designs and implements integrated marketing and communications plans that elevate our brand and help accelerate transformative social change. Marc also provides high-level counsel to donor teams, co-creating strategies that amplify philanthropic investments in bold solutions to some of the world’s biggest problems.
Previously, Marc ran his own communications consulting firm, after heading the communications and marketing efforts of the Hilton Foundation and managing the daily operations of the Hilton Humanitarian Prize. Prior to the Hilton Foundation, he worked in communications, education and events management in Europe, Asia, and the U.S.
He was awarded a Master of Communication Management degree from the USC’s Annenberg School for Communication and Journalism. He serves on the boards of the Communications Network and the NEA Foundation.
